Your first week with dassi
The goal isn’t “AI everywhere.” The goal is to remove the repeatable browser overhead that steals your day.
Day 1: Pick one high-frequency workflow
- Choose one app you touch daily (email, CRM, docs, dashboards).
- Ask dassi to do the safe part first (summarize, draft, label, preview).
Day 2–3: Make it repeatable
- Save a prompt template (format, tone, what to include/exclude).
- Define guardrails: “never send/submit without confirmation.”
Day 4–5: Connect tabs (without integrations)
- Read context in one tab and write results into another tab (CRM, Docs, Sheets).

Safety checklist
- For actions (send, submit, delete), require explicit confirmation.
- Prefer structured outputs: checklists, tables, and short briefs you can reuse.
